What is Handmade Furniture?

Handmade furniture is specified as any piece that is constructed without making use of automated processes or equipment. Craftsmen and ladies utilize traditional techniques and personal touches, which leads to unique, high-quality products. From strong wood dining tables to intricately created chairs, handmade furniture deals with a broad spectrum of tastes and styles.

The Process of Creating Handmade Furniture

Producing handmade furniture is a precise process. Each step needs skill, persistence, and a keen eye for detail. Here's a general overview of what goes into crafting a handmade piece:

  1. Design and Planning: The craftsmen starts by sketching designs and considering the functionality of the piece.
  2. Product Selection: Quality products are selected, frequently sourced in your area or sustainably. Typical choices consist of hardwoods like oak, walnut, and cherry.
  3. Building: Using traditional methods, artisans shape, join, and end up the furniture. This procedure might involve woodworking, upholstery, or metalworking strategies.
  4. Completing Touches: Once the structure is complete, artisans use surfaces, stains, or paints, choosing items that boost sturdiness and visual appeal.
  5. Final Inspection: Before it reaches the customer, the piece undergoes a comprehensive examination to make sure quality and craftsmanship.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: How much does handmade furniture usually cost?

A: Prices for handmade furniture can differ commonly based upon the materials utilized, the complexity of the design, and the artisan's reputation. Typically, handmade pieces might cost more than mass-produced items due to the labor-intensive processes included.

Q2: How do I take care of handmade furniture?

A: Caring for handmade furniture often includes routine dusting, avoiding direct sunshine to avoid fading, and using proper cleansing products. Particular care standards can be offered by the artisan at the time of sale.

Q3: Can I customize my piece?

A: Most handmade furniture shops provide personalization options, permitting you to select dimensions, surfaces, and in some cases even design components to fit your preferences.

Q4: What kinds of furniture can I discover in handmade shops?

A: Handmade furniture stores can carry a variety of products, including tables, chairs, cabinets, beds, and decorative accents, with designs varying from rustic to contemporary.

Q5: Is handmade furniture worth the investment?

A: Handmade furniture typically offers better quality, individuality, and sturdiness than mass-produced items. Lots of buyers discover that the financial investment is validated by the craftsmanship and durability of the pieces.
